Sue Herndon McCollum Community Center
The Sue Herndon McCollum Community Center, located at 501 Ingleside Avenue in Tallahassee, Florida, is a hub of activity for the entire family. Originally known as Lafayette Park Community Center, this facility offers a wide range of classes and activities for both active and passive recreation. The center, which includes an Arts and Crafts Center, playground, softball field, tennis courts, and a 1-mile course trail, is situated in a 22-acre park that provides ample space for fun and relaxation. One of the highlights of the center is the Playcamp program, which has been running since 1966. This fee-based camp offers a mix of active and passive games for children aged 5 to 12, with small camper to counselor ratios to ensure a personalized experience. In addition to Playcamp, the center also hosts Fun Days on teacher planning days and school holidays, as well as extended camps during Spring Break, Thanksgiving, and other holidays.
Lafayette Park
Lafayette Park is a charming and vibrant institution located at 501 Ingleside Avenue in Tallahassee, Florida. It is not only a popular tourist attraction but also a hub for creativity and community engagement. The Lafayette Arts and Crafts Center, which has been in operation for over 50 years, offers a variety of classes and programs for both youth and adults. From pottery and stained glass to crochet and drawing, there is something for everyone to explore their artistic talents. The center features well-equipped classrooms, a pottery lab, and three kilns, making it a perfect space for individuals to unleash their creativity. Adjacent to the Sue McCollum Community Center, Lafayette Arts and Crafts Center is a welcoming and inclusive place for people of all backgrounds to come together and express themselves through art.

Jack L. McLean Jr. Park Community Center
The Jack L. McLean Jr. Park Community Center, located at 700 Paul Russell Road in Tallahassee, Florida, is a 52-acre park that offers a wide range of recreational facilities for both active and passive enjoyment. Named after former City Commissioner Jack L. McLean Jr., the park features covered picnic shelters, playgrounds, basketball and tennis courts, bike trails, and a disc golf course. The 20,386 square foot recreation center includes a gymnasium, weight room, and multi-purpose rooms for various activities and events. The aquatics complex boasts a zero depth entry pool with play equipment, a water slide, and a lap pool for swimming and aerobics. The bathhouse provides shower facilities and office space for lifeguards.

Florida State University Aquatics
Florida State University Aquatics, located at 118 Varsity Way in Tallahassee, Florida, offers a wide range of water-based programs and classes for Campus Recreation patrons. With a 16-lane indoor lap pool, spa, sauna, and steam rooms, FSU Aquatics provides opportunities for recreational swimming as well as American Red Cross certification courses in First Aid, CPR/AED, Lifeguarding, and Water Safety Instruction. Adult Swim Lessons are also available for those looking to improve their swimming skills. The Leach Pool is a state-of-the-art facility with 16 lanes and diving boards ranging from 1 to 3 meters in height. Additionally, there are whirlpool spas, steam rooms, and a sauna for patrons to relax and unwind after a swim. Lifeguards are on duty to ensure the safety of all swimmers and enforce facility regulations.
